Its rougly 9,347 times harder to launch than the GA... I'll figure it out though.
I had a '95 Z-28 which is similar (though about 50hp shy of WS6 land output) and I quickly learned the trick to a smooth, consistant launch was to go from ~10% throttle to full throttle over about half a car length of roll out.
Your car, being a tad more muscular than my Z was, probably needs a bit more "easing off" than mine did.
